What will the weather in Parksley be like during my vacation?
July and August are typically the warmest months in Parksley when the average temp is 76°F. January and February are the coldest months when the average temperature is 43°F. August and October are the months with the most rain.

Unveiling Parksley: A Journey Through History and Hidden Treasures

Nestled on Virginia's Eastern Shore, Parksley is a charming small town that invites travelers to step back in time. Known for its rich railroad history, the Parksley Train Station Museum showcases vintage locomotives and memorabilia. Stroll through the picturesque streets lined with quaint shops and local eateries, and experience the warmth of Southern hospitality. Just a short drive away, explore the stunning landscapes of nearby nature preserves and pristine beaches. Parksley offers a delightful blend of culture and tranquility, making it an ideal spot for those seeking an off-the-beaten-path escape filled with history and charm.

Best time to go to Parksley

Parksley exper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 39.6°F (4.2°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 78.6°F (25.9°C). August t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Parksley are June to August,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by light rainfall. In contrast, February, October, and December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
